Title: Satoshi Ohtaka: Innovator in Printer Technology
Introduction
Satoshi Ohtaka is a notable inventor based in Ibaraki, Japan. He has made significant contributions to the field of printer technology, holding a total of 4 patents. His innovative designs focus on enhancing the functionality and efficiency of printers.
Latest Patents
One of Ohtaka's latest patents is an "Expendable Supply for Printer." This invention includes a memory that stores the timing of the last warning after a recommended limit. The printer's warning generator determines whether to generate a warning based on specific operations. A warning is generated when certain conditions are met, ensuring users are notified about the usability limits of the expendable supply. Another key patent involves a printer that integrates an expendable supply, a detector for various operations, and a warning generator that alerts users when the recommended limit has been exceeded. This innovative approach aims to improve user experience and prevent unexpected interruptions during printing tasks.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Satoshi Ohtaka has worked with prominent companies, including Mitsubishi Petrochemical Company Limited and Riso Kagaku Corporation. His experience in these organizations has allowed him to refine his skills and contribute to advancements in printer technology.
Collaborations
Ohtaka has collaborated with talented individuals in the field, including Makoto Imanari and Hiroshi Iwane. These partnerships have fostered a creative environment that encourages innovation and the development of new ideas.
